Tennessee's humid subtropical climate, with hot summers and mild winters, influences ADU construction schedules. While building is possible year-round, extreme humidity can affect concrete curing and exterior finishing. We aim to schedule critical exterior work during the more temperate spring and fall months.

What is the best season for ADU construction in Tennessee?

Spring and fall generally offer the most pleasant weather for ADU construction in Tennessee, avoiding the peak heat of summer. This allows for more efficient exterior work and material application. We plan accordingly.

Can I build an ADU in Tennessee in just 24 hours?

A '24-hour ADU' is not a realistic timeframe for any construction project. The process involves thorough planning, obtaining necessary permits, and the actual building phases. We focus on efficient, quality construction, not impossible speed.
